    Design Details

    Material: Cotton linen

    Color: Ivory

    •  A style that's come to be our signature, this pant features straight silhouette that gives a relaxed look.
    • Crafted in ivory cotton linen with chikankari, it pairs perfectly crop tops and shirt blouses promising as adoration piece in your closet.
    • Embellished with teipchi, ghaspatti, orma, pechni stitches.

    Excellence of Craft

    At Sangraha Atelier we use natural fabrics and vernacular craft techniques and celebrate variations of color, design and slight irregularities as a promise of being handcrafted, exquisite and one-of-its-kind piece. The process of product making is extensive and needs endurance. A needle almost penetrates a textile at least ten thousand times to create an artisanal product.
